Integrando bancos de dados heterogêneos através do padrão XML

Detalhes bibliográficos
Ano de defesa: 2002
Autor(a) principal: Ferrandin, Mauri
Orientador(a): Camargo, Murilo Silva de
Banca de defesa: Não Informado pela instituição
Tipo de documento: Dissertação
Tipo de acesso: Acesso aberto
Idioma: por
Instituição de defesa: Florianópolis, SC
Programa de Pós-Graduação: Não Informado pela instituição
Departamento: Não Informado pela instituição
País: Não Informado pela instituição
Link de acesso: http://repositorio.ufsc.br/xmlui/handle/123456789/83581
Resumo: Dissertação (mestrado) - Universidade Federal de Santa Catarina, Centro Tecnológico. Programa de Pós-Graduação em Ciência da Computação.
id UFSC_951b547989c40ae83e9e04dab4d61f4c
oai_identifier_str oai:repositorio.ufsc.br:123456789/83581
network_acronym_str UFSC
network_name_str Repositório Institucional da UFSC
repository_id_str
spelling Universidade Federal de Santa CatarinaFerrandin, MauriCamargo, Murilo Silva de2012-10-20T01:20:22Z2012-10-20T01:20:22Z20022002189847http://repositorio.ufsc.br/xmlui/handle/123456789/83581Dissertação (mestrado) - Universidade Federal de Santa Catarina, Centro Tecnológico. Programa de Pós-Graduação em Ciência da Computação.Com objetivo de organizar e estruturar o armazenamento das informações necessárias às organizações, SGBDs são utilizados a fim de prover o acesso de maneira ágil, eficiente e segura a estas informações pelas aplicações. Os dados armazenados em um SGBD são organizados de acordo com um esquema definido em cada organização, assim, quando estas precisam integrar/trocar informações armazenadas em seus respectivos bancos de dados, vários problemas surgem devido a heterogeneidade dos esquemas ou plataformas de hardware/software, necessitando de uma estrutura capaz de mediar tal intercâmbio. Para prover a integração de diversos bancos de dados heterogêneos, são utilizados os Sistemas Gerenciados de Bancos de Dados Distribuídos Heterogêneos, que controlam e possibilitam as aplicações acesso de maneira transparente aos dados distribuídos entre as bases heterogêneas. Com a especificação do padrão XML, o mesmo passou a ser utilizado para intercâmbio de dados, uma vez que é capaz de agregar a seu conteúdo informações que o descrevem(metadados), possibilitando assim a representação de dados que não poderiam ser representadas através do modelo relacional utilizado pela maioria dos SGBDs. Com o padrão XML é possível então a criação de visões materializadas dos dados armazenados em um SGBD local e utilizar esta visão para os mais variados fins. O presente trabalho apresenta uma proposta de um sistema capaz de prover o acesso - de maneira integrada e transparente para as aplicações - às informações armazenadas em bases heterogêneas e distribuídas, utilizando o padrão XML para representa-las através da criação de visões materializadas dos dados presentes em cada uma das bases a serem integradas, agrupando posteriormente as diversas visões em uma única visão XML. Tal integração traz a tona uma série de questões a serem tratadas, como a integridade dos dados que antes era controlada por cada um dos SGBDs e que agora precisa ser observada na visão integrada para garantir que os dados nela presentes possuam a mesma integridade, possibilitando assim que haja um serialização dos dados entre a visão e as bases distribuídas sem que ocorram problemas de integridade.ii, 107 f.| il., tabs.porFlorianópolis, SCInformaticaCiência da computaçãoBanco de dadosXML (Linguagem de marcação de documento)Integrando bancos de dados heterogêneos através do padrão XMLinfo:eu-repo/semantics/publishedVersioninfo:eu-repo/semantics/masterThesisreponame:Repositório Institucional da UFSCinstname:Universidade Federal de Santa Catarina (UFSC)instacron:UFSCinfo:eu-repo/semantics/openAccessORIGINAL189847.pdfapplication/pdf1046371https://repositorio.ufsc.br/bitstream/123456789/83581/1/189847.pdf18e9996c78c4c3e40cf7315df0130e54MD51TEXT189847.pdf.txt189847.pdf.txtExtracted Texttext/plain207828https://repositorio.ufsc.br/bitstream/123456789/83581/2/189847.pdf.txt4037b525c0d85fdabaf069eeb93ef9f8MD52THUMBNAIL189847.pdf.jpg189847.pdf.jpgGenerated Thumbnailimage/jpeg1305https://repositorio.ufsc.br/bitstream/123456789/83581/3/189847.pdf.jpge8193c5a42ba1f5206e4f4d1eb075a17MD53123456789/835812013-05-02 15:37:09.999oai:repositorio.ufsc.br:123456789/83581Repositório InstitucionalPUBhttp://150.162.242.35/oai/requestsandra.sobrera@ufsc.bropendoar:23732013-05-02T18:37:09Repositório Institucional da UFSC - Universidade Federal de Santa Catarina (UFSC)false
dc.title.pt_BR.fl_str_mv Integrando bancos de dados heterogêneos através do padrão XML
title Integrando bancos de dados heterogêneos através do padrão XML
spellingShingle Integrando bancos de dados heterogêneos através do padrão XML
Ferrandin, Mauri
Informatica
Ciência da computação
Banco de dados
XML (Linguagem de marcação de documento)
title_short Integrando bancos de dados heterogêneos através do padrão XML
title_full Integrando bancos de dados heterogêneos através do padrão XML
title_fullStr Integrando bancos de dados heterogêneos através do padrão XML
title_full_unstemmed Integrando bancos de dados heterogêneos através do padrão XML
title_sort Integrando bancos de dados heterogêneos através do padrão XML
author Ferrandin, Mauri
author_facet Ferrandin, Mauri
author_role author
dc.contributor.pt_BR.fl_str_mv Universidade Federal de Santa Catarina
dc.contributor.author.fl_str_mv Ferrandin, Mauri
dc.contributor.advisor1.fl_str_mv Camargo, Murilo Silva de
contributor_str_mv Camargo, Murilo Silva de
dc.subject.classification.pt_BR.fl_str_mv Informatica
Ciência da computação
Banco de dados
XML (Linguagem de marcação de documento)
topic Informatica
Ciência da computação
Banco de dados
XML (Linguagem de marcação de documento)
description Dissertação (mestrado) - Universidade Federal de Santa Catarina, Centro Tecnológico. Programa de Pós-Graduação em Ciência da Computação.
publishDate 2002
dc.date.submitted.pt_BR.fl_str_mv 2002
dc.date.issued.fl_str_mv 2002
dc.date.accessioned.fl_str_mv 2012-10-20T01:20:22Z
dc.date.available.fl_str_mv 2012-10-20T01:20:22Z
dc.type.status.fl_str_mv info:eu-repo/semantics/publishedVersion
dc.type.driver.fl_str_mv info:eu-repo/semantics/masterThesis
format masterThesis
status_str publishedVersion
dc.identifier.uri.fl_str_mv http://repositorio.ufsc.br/xmlui/handle/123456789/83581
dc.identifier.other.pt_BR.fl_str_mv 189847
identifier_str_mv 189847
url http://repositorio.ufsc.br/xmlui/handle/123456789/83581
dc.language.iso.fl_str_mv por
language por
dc.rights.driver.fl_str_mv info:eu-repo/semantics/openAccess
eu_rights_str_mv openAccess
dc.format.none.fl_str_mv ii, 107 f.| il., tabs.
dc.publisher.none.fl_str_mv Florianópolis, SC
publisher.none.fl_str_mv Florianópolis, SC
dc.source.none.fl_str_mv reponame:Repositório Institucional da UFSC
instname:Universidade Federal de Santa Catarina (UFSC)
instacron:UFSC
instname_str Universidade Federal de Santa Catarina (UFSC)
instacron_str UFSC
institution UFSC
reponame_str Repositório Institucional da UFSC
collection Repositório Institucional da UFSC
bitstream.url.fl_str_mv https://repositorio.ufsc.br/bitstream/123456789/83581/1/189847.pdf
https://repositorio.ufsc.br/bitstream/123456789/83581/2/189847.pdf.txt
https://repositorio.ufsc.br/bitstream/123456789/83581/3/189847.pdf.jpg
bitstream.checksum.fl_str_mv 18e9996c78c4c3e40cf7315df0130e54
4037b525c0d85fdabaf069eeb93ef9f8
e8193c5a42ba1f5206e4f4d1eb075a17
bitstream.checksumAlgorithm.fl_str_mv MD5
MD5
MD5
repository.name.fl_str_mv Repositório Institucional da UFSC - Universidade Federal de Santa Catarina (UFSC)
repository.mail.fl_str_mv sandra.sobrera@ufsc.br
_version_ 1851759174085509120